Constraint Cellular Automata for Urban Development Simulation: An Application to the Strasbourg-KehlQuantification is based on Markov chains and location on transition rules. The proposed approach is implemented on the Strasbourg-Kehl cross-border area and calibrated with three contrasting prospective scenarios to try to predict cross-border territorial development.

The Influence of Scale in LULC Modeling. A Comparison Between Two Different LULC Maps (SIOSE and CORe compared the input and simulated maps using spatial metrics and the matrix proposed by Pontius and Millones to find out the quantity and allocation disagreement. The results can provide a better understanding of the implications of the choice of input maps in LULC modeling.

Urban Land Use Change Analysis and Modeling: A Case Study of the Gaza Stripp based on sound, accurate information. This study combines the use of satellite remote sensing with geographic information systems (GISs). The spatial database was developed by using six Landsat images taken in 1972, 1982, 1990, 2002, 2013 and 2014, together with different geodatabases for those ye
